The Impact of Stoicism on Ancient Culture

There is a widespread assumption or belief that the Roman legal system was deeply influenced by stoicism. It used to be thought quite widely, especially 19th century scholars working from backgrounds of Hegelian idealism,. But we can't really say that any particular ideas in Roman jurist's prudential texts definitely come from stoic principles or neoplatonic principles. I'm thinking of things like ideas about natural reason, about natural law. The Roman jurists refer to as the Eus Gentium, the idea that there are certain types of law which are shared by all peoples across the globe.
